Color palette transitions in OBT! Aka, Woo gets owned by color theory.

Folks who have been following OBT for some time may have noticed a slight shift in colors over the years. This is something that’s most prominent in the lineart, which went from a mid brown:

To a much darker brown:

This was due to wanting more contrast with lines, and also due to getting owned by color theory! While I liked the softer look the brown lines gave, they also had a tendency to sort of muddy the colors of the comic, which made vibrants scenes look… Not so vibrant. Take for example the Marowak Dojo in Chapter 3 vs Chapter 4:

The latest rendition certainly is a lot more striking! Which isn’t to say that having a faded palette was bad, it just wasn’t what I wanted for my art going forward. Though this transition definitely had some rough patches, and still needs a lot of tweaking to get it where I want! This particular page from Chapter 3 had a lot of growing pains compared to later pages:

To accommodate for the darker lineart, I had to really tweak character palettes to get just what I wanted out of them! You might notice that Malachi’s yellow highlights aren’t nearly as deeply saturated as they are in later pages, as an example.

It’s a difficult process to work through, but I’ve been making the journey one step at a time! My current weakness is background palettes, but as time goes on I’m sure they’ll come along.
